文章目录简介安装基础用法高级用法简介Starknet.js是一个类似于ethers.js的库,提供了一系列API,能够将用户使用JavaScript/TypeScript语言编写的DAPP连接到Starknet网络,并执行declare、deploy、execute等功能。get-starknet提供了一个hook,能够使StarknetDAPP和钱包无缝连接,支持多种钱包、多种模式。安装在react项目文件夹根目录下执行以下命令以安装starknet.js和get-starknet。#usingnpmnpminstallget-starknetstarknet@next#usingyarny
是否可以在距离或指定半径内使用D3获得所有RECT元素。如果可能的话,有人可以分享一个示例。以下是我的场景:在这里,使用主流,我需要在主流周围获得所有小矩形的ID。看答案您可以按公式计算到点之间的距离Math.sqrt(Math.pow(X1-X2,2)+Math.pow(Y1-Y2,2))这是我的小提琴示例。在红色正方形上徘徊,找到一个圆圈中居中的很少的正方形
我目前正在研究运输数据的可视化,并且我正在尝试创建一个线图,其中Xaxis在特定的一天中为00:00至23:59,在此期间,Yaxis是特定分钟的船舶数量天。我设法创建了一个包含1440个对象的数组(每分钟一个)。该数组中的每个对象看起来如下:00:00小时的数据对象在00:01小时内带有数据的对象这是我用来创建所述数组的代码段。varshipTotal=d3.nest().key(function(d){returnd.Timestamp;}).sortKeys(d3.ascending).rollup(function(d){returnd3.sum(d,function(g){retur
目前依托公链开发链游,是最普遍的也是最方便的形式,如BSC、Solana、AVAX上线的游戏,将游戏嫁接到链上,充值提现的资金的管控也交由链上,相对来说更加安全、稳妥。公链的质量:这里一是指基础设施问题,二是公链的拓展性,对于游戏,玩家在体验中存在着大量且快速的交互行为,所以一定要选择低延迟、拓展性强的公链。那么新游戏在选择公链时应该去看什么条件呢?2.公链嫁接的难度:游戏设计上并没有加大难度,目前主要是在代币与公链的资金流进行结合、和NFT交易市场的结合。
D3.js(全称:Data-DrivenDocuments)数据驱动文档是一个基于数据驱动DOM的JS库。相比EChart、G2…之类的封装好的图标库,D3就像一个Jquery。封装了很多函数供开发者使用。为什么总觉得D3难不常用就会忘记。当我们面对一个简单图表时永远首选会使用EChart一类封装好的图表库。D3的案例很多,但是D3的API变化也较多。网上会有很多个人写的案例,根据网友写的案例去学习,经常性会有示例代码无法运行的问题。D3.js的教程很多、但好的教程相对较少。D3的官方教程是以核心概念为主。今天这次分享最主要想推荐一本书:fullstackd3.js。fullstackd3.j
Web3.js使用的实用介绍原文 作者:wissalhaji欢迎订阅《Solidity智能合约零基础开发教程专栏》系列文章。如果你一直在跟着这个系列学习,那么你已经掌握了编写自己的智能合约。因此,今天给大家介绍一下构建去中心化应用的全貌,并向大家介绍一下web3.js,这是构建dapp不可缺失部分。在深入了解web3.js是什么以及它的工作原理之前,我想先回答一个简单的问题-为什么选择web3.js?来开启这个话题:图片来源:
1.首先,在项目中安装D3.js和Vue3.0:npminstalld3@^7.0.0npminstallvue@^3.0.02.Vue组件中引入D3.jsimport*asd3from'd3';3. 在Vue组件中定义一个data对象,用于存储拓扑结构的节点和边:data(){return{nodes:[{id:1,name:'Node1'},{id:2,name:'Node2'},{id:3,name:'Node3'}],links:[{source:1,target:2},{source:1,target:3}]}}4. 在Vue组件的mounted生命周期中使用D3.js绘制拓扑结构
前言本篇主要记录学习Vue并实际参与完结web3门户项目的经验和走过的弯路。拖了这么久才来还债,说项目忙那是借口,还是因为个人懒!从自学到实战Vue实际中间就1周的学习熟悉时间,学习不够深就会造成基础不稳,多次推翻重来的情况,从架子搭设到实际页面功能都存在这种情况,说来真是惭愧。最终,算是圆满完工吧。一、项目框架1.打包方式vue新建项目打包方式分2种(其他的方式暂未学习):1.使用webpack工具学习时参照了bilibili教学老师的打包方式,也就是上篇文章(自学Vue开发Dapp去中心化钱包(二))介绍的,之后按照这个新建项目开始开发web3门户。命令如下:vueinitwebpack项
我正在使用Flask作为Web框架,并且我正在尝试实现MikeDewar着的D3入门一书中的第一个示例。我有一个名为run.py的Python脚本和两个目录,templates/和static/,其中包含index.html和service_status.json,分别。不幸的是,我的代码根本没有呈现数据,也没有产生任何明显的错误。这是我在run.py中的内容:#!/usr/bin/envpythonfromflaskimportFlask,render_template,url_forapp=Flask(__name__)@app.route('/')defindex():retur
我对Shiny和R有一个公平的理解,但是我只是开始使用JavaScript,并且从未在HTML或CSS中进行编码。我想学习使用d3.js建造可折叠树(类似这个)是否可以参考任何教程将D3.J集成到Shiny中?我遇到了Collapsibetree软件包但是我想学习如何建立一个。任何帮助将不胜感激!看答案这是使用的minimap示例diamonds数据集。您可以在这里找到更多示例https://github.com/adeelk93/collapsibletreelibrary(shiny)#install.packages("collapsibleTree")library(collapsib